Kristin Fredrickson and Eric Kramer to Deliver Welcome Keynote at Longwood Garden’s Designing Change
Kristin Fredrickson and Eric Kramer will keynote Designing Change: Landscape Continuity in an Age of Uncertainty, a thought-provoking symposium curated by Anita Berrizbeitia, Professor of Landscape Architecture at Harvard’s Graduate School of Design. Held October 15 & 16 at Longwood Gardens, this gathering invites practitioners, scholars, and visionaries to confront today’s challenges and chart a course for continuity, resilience, and design in an era of profound change.
Designing Change coincides with the unprecedented relocation and reconstruction of the Cascade Garden—a modern masterwork by celebrated Brazilian landscape architect Roberto Burle Marx—as part of the Longwood Reimagined project we created with architects Weiss Manfredi. Gain behind-the-scenes insight into one of the most ambitious preservation efforts in contemporary history, and how it may serve as a roadmap for preservation efforts of cultural landscape in the future.
